    Indoor tracks in DC Area with 8-lap-per-mile indoor tracks:

  • PG Sports and Learning Complex -- open to the public free mornings 6-10 am
  • Thomas Jefferson Community Center -- open to the public, $5 for Arlington residents; $10 for others
  • Episcopal High School -- odd track, open odd hours
  • Georgetown University Yates Field House -- formerly $5 per visit with GU host, maybe more now
  • George Mason University Field House -- closed to the public, except on special occasions
  • Some private gyms have 10-lap-per-mile indoor tracks
